My e92 m3 had a super annoying b pillar rattle. Of course the dealer heard nothing. I ended up removing it myself and added dynamat and foam. But the removal of the rear door panel and breaking the factory seal seemed to end up causing more rattles. In your case I would hope that the noise goes away when the plastics expand and contract a bit in winter and summer.

No but thanks! Mine is driving me nuts. I have removed and applyed felt tape to every conceivable trim piece. A pillar cover, lower side dash cover, overhead consul , visor mounts. Dash mounting bolts. Also went over all fittings under the hood next to the windshield inc the chassis bracing . The noise is a snapping that comes from the upper corner on the passenger side of the windshield. I have even lowered the headliner and couldn't find anything. The tech who is pretty sharp said that i have tried all the possible areas . I'll tell you one thing, i have gotten real good at removing trim. although there's defiantly a learning curve! Anybody have any ideas? carl
